Criminal Justice (Associate in Science Degree)
Criminal Justice (Associate in
Science Degree)
This program
provides a broad overview of the field of criminal justice and will
prepare students for careers in this field. Program graduates may be
employed as law enforcement officers, correctional officers, case workers,
and court advocates.
